Picture of the ruins of an ancient hillfortSome ancient Islay history, a hill fort (or better, what remains of it) in the south of Islay. Along the ridge one of the walls, the round(ish) area bottom middle is believed to have been the guardhouse with the entrance just opposite. I think this was at An Dùn, but there are a number of old hill forts and duns in the area.
